Is White Hominy Gluten Free?

Yes, white hominy is gluten-free. Derived from corn, a naturally gluten-free grain, it undergoes a process that makes it safe for those with celiac disease or gluten intolerance. In this analysis, we break down the specific ingredients found in standard white hominy to confirm its safety and nutritional profile.

The Ingredient Breakdown

To understand why white hominy is safe for a gluten-free diet, we need to look at the specific chemical process and ingredients used. The product in question contains WHITE HOMINY PREPARED WITH WATER, SALT, SODIUM BISULFITE. Let's analyze each component.

The primary ingredient is corn. Unlike wheat, barley, and rye, corn does not contain gluten. The transformation of dried corn into hominy involves a process called nixtamalization, where the corn is soaked in an alkaline solution (often lime or lye). This process actually removes the hull and germ, but more importantly, it does not introduce any gluten. In fact, studies suggest that nixtamalization can reduce mycotoxin levels in corn, making it safer.

Looking at the additives: Water and Salt are obviously gluten-free. The Sodium Bisulfite is a preservative used to maintain color and prevent spoilage. This is a synthetic salt and contains no gluten. There is no wheat flour used as an anti-caking agent here, nor is there any malt flavoring derived from barley.

While the corn itself is the only potential source of concern regarding cross-contamination, processed white hominy is generally considered a whole food product. Unlike oat processing, where shared equipment with wheat is a major issue, hominy is typically processed in dedicated corn facilities. Therefore, based on the ingredient list provided, this product is unequivocally gluten-free.


Nutritional Value

White hominy is a complex carbohydrate that serves as an excellent energy source. It is naturally low in fat, with most varieties containing less than 1 gram of fat per serving. It is also cholesterol-free.

In terms of sugar content, plain white hominy is very low, typically containing 0 to 1 gram of naturally occurring sugar per serving. This makes it a much better option than processed breakfast cereals or baked goods for those monitoring blood sugar levels. However, because it is a starchy vegetable, it is higher in calories than leafy greens—typically around 120 calories per cup. It fits well into a balanced diet, particularly the Mediterranean or DASH diets, as it provides fiber and essential minerals like magnesium and selenium without adding saturated fats.
